Reality check. Clay Aiken was not the inspiration for this song. "Grown-Up Christmas List" first appeared back in 1990, on David Foster's album "River of Love". The vocals on that track were by the great Natalie Cole. Amy Grant then released a version on her 1992 holiday album that made the tune popular.
